Cats, much like us, communicate through scents. When you kiss a cat, you're essentially leaving a part of yourself behind. It's like a secret code that says, "I'm yours." But remember, cats have a way of interpreting these scents in their own unique way.
While some cats might enjoy a gentle peck, others might not be as keen on the idea. It's all about personal preference. Some cats might even see a kiss as a playful invitation to more human contact, like a game of "catch me if you can."
Have you ever noticed cats nose-to-nose? It's not just a cute display of affection; it's a way for cats to exchange information. Just like humans, cats can learn a lot about each other through scent. It's a form of "kissing" in the feline world, but it's a lot less about romance and more about survival.
